The Mid-Level Analytical Engineer independently performs stress analysis, creep and fatigue evaluations, and fracture mechanics assessments for heavy equipment within the power generation and energy industries, particularly supporting combined cycle and conventional boiler power plants. This role combines advanced technical execution with client interaction and mentorship of junior staff. The position primarily supports life assessment, reliability evaluation, and failure investigation projects for operating industrial assets.
Responsibilities
• Lead finite element and fracture mechanics analyses addressing thermo-mechanical behavior, creep deformation, and fatigue life
• Perform life assessment calculations related to creep, fatigue, and crack growth mechanisms
• Interpret material behavior and apply established industry methodologies and best practices
• Prepare and deliver technical reports, client presentations, and calculation packages; respond to client technical inquiries and provide engineering recommendations
• Participate in proposal development, project scoping discussions, and technical business development activities
Required Qualifications
• B.S., M.S., or Ph.D. in Mechanical Engineering, Civil Engineering, or a closely related engineering discipline
• M.S. or Ph.D.: 6+ years of relevant engineering experience
• B.S.: 8+ years of relevant industry experience
• Knowledge of power generation and energy industry systems, particularly combined cycle and conventional boiler-fueled power plants
• Demonstrated experience with materials degradation mechanisms including creep, fatigue, and high-temperature material behavior
• Proficiency in applied fracture mechanics principles
• Working knowledge of fitness-for-service (FFS) assessment methodologies
• Proficiency with Abaqus or ANSYS finite element analysis software
• Proficiency with SolidWorks or comparable CAD software
• Strong written and verbal communication skills, including technical documentation and client interaction
• Willingness to travel approximately 10–15% annually to industrial environments to support site assessment teams and project execution
Enhanced Qualifications
• Programming or scripting experience in Python, R, or VBA to support automation of analysis workflows
• Professional Engineer (P.E.) licensure or progress toward licensure
• Knowledge of ASME Boiler & Pressure Vessel Code requirements
• Familiarity with EPRI materials and analytical programs
• Participation in ASME Code Committees or related industry technical groups
• Awareness of EPRI materials programs such as CSEF, MRP, and BWRVIP
Typical Projects and Deliverables
• Lead technical tasks as part of multidisciplinary project teams (typically 1–3 engineers), deliver complete report sections, and represent SI in client technical meetings
• Independently develop FEA models, perform sensitivity studies, and provide actionable engineering recommendations supporting inspection planning, repair strategies, and design modifications
